PUBLISHED POEMS

The year was 1982 and New Worlds Unlimited published two of my poems in their anthology, Dreams of the Heroic Muse.

LOVE VISITED

Love visited me once
on a moonlit night
lasting six months;
I grew,
was nourished
became almost human
as my being sought a home.
I held the moon at arm’s length
and watched it grow small
as its certain cycle
continued to darkness.
The baying of dogs rings untrue,
the sky is empty.

I wrote the following poem in remembrance of my grandmother.

ROSES

Roses were her love,
great flowing rainbows of pink, red and white.
Her children, small strangers would come
and each take home
a fist full of gaily colored affection.

Roses were her love,
And when rest had finally come from roses
roses were hers,
Elegant creations of empty colors
looking out on empty eyes.

Roses were her love,
And now her small garden
has yet to discover
a rose.
